Ray Blair

Ray Blair joined Motherwell in 1984 coming from St Johnstone. A small but determined midfield player he would play over 50 games in Claret & Amber before moving on to East Fife where he was part of the deal which would bring future ‘well legend Steve Kirk to Fir Park. He would later have a brief spell in Australia with East Adelaide.
